容器
容器技术(如 Docker、Kubernetes)的动态性、轻量化特性,使其在微服务、DevOps 等场景中广泛应用,但也带来了 “部署密集、生命周期短、资源共享” 等监控挑战。容器监控的核心目标是 “实时掌握容器及集群的运行状态、资源消耗、业务健康度”。
前置条件
若要使用平台的容器监控能力,需要先安装平台探针SmartAgent、SmartGate。具体安装方法可参考探针安装。
使用场景
- 容器资源消耗监控与优化:容器的 “资源隔离性” 依赖于 Cgroups 等技术,但单节点上容器密集部署时,易出现 “资源争抢”(如 CPU 抢占、内存溢出、磁盘 I/O 瓶颈),需通过监控实现资源动态调配与优化。
- 容器生命周期与故障排查:容器的生命周期短(创建、运行、销毁可能仅几分钟),且故障具有 “扩散快、隐蔽性强” 的特点,需通过监控追踪容器状态、定位故障根因。
- 容器化业务与应用性能保障:容器是业务应用的载体,需通过监控关联 “容器资源” 与 “业务指标”,确保应用在容器环境中稳定运行。
开始使用
1、进入基础设施 -> 容器 页面,可查看当前通过探针采集的容器列表,展示容器基本信息及指标数据

2、容器详情展示容器中关键进程信息,包括PID,PPID和进程关键指标CPU利用率和RSS内存占用。其次展示容器的上下依赖关系,可以获知容器运行所在的主机,及容器内的进程组实例和服务实例。帮助您快速了解当前容器的上下依赖实体情况。
日志模块展示该容器内采集到的日志数据
容器见解功能中,可以获知容器最近7天的健康评分情况及趋势变化。可以了解最近7天的部署变更情况,比如新部署的进程组等信息。
